Why Chicken Road became popular and what kind of title it is

Chicken Road is usually grouped with crash-style or reflex-driven gambling games rather than classic five-reel slots. That difference explains most of its appeal. The concept is simple enough to understand in seconds: the round progresses, the potential multiplier rises, and the player decides when to cash out before the run fails. The tension comes from timing, not from waiting for line combinations.

This format became popular because it creates a very direct sense of control, even though the outcome still depends on chance. Players often describe it as more active than a standard slot session. You are making frequent decisions, rounds are short, and results arrive quickly. That speed is a major attraction, but it is also one of the biggest risks for bankroll discipline.

Another reason for the game’s popularity is visual clarity. Chicken Road usually does not bury the player under too many symbols, side meters, and layered features. The presentation is often playful, but the structure is sharp: start, watch, decide, repeat. That simplicity makes it easy for new users to enter, though not always easy for them to manage their pace once real money play begins.

A useful observation here: Chicken Road often feels “easier” than a slot because the rules are obvious, but it can be harder on decision-making because every extra second invites overconfidence. That gap between simple rules and risky behaviour is one of the most important things to understand before launching it at Paddy power casino.

Chicken Road mechanics in plain English: pace, payouts, and core features

At its core, Chicken Road is built around a rising value and a failure point that can happen before the player cashes out. In plain English, you are watching the round develop and trying to leave with a result before the run ends. If you cash out in time, the return reflects the multiplier reached at that moment. If not, the stake is lost for that round.

This is very different from a standard slot payout model. There are no classic paylines to evaluate, and there may be no free-spin sequence in the familiar sense. The main feature is the escalating risk curve. That means the emotional rhythm is sharper. Early exits produce smaller returns more often, while late exits carry more risk and less consistency.

Volatility is therefore an important concept, even if the title explains it only briefly. In practical terms, Chicken Road can feel volatile because the temptation to wait for a higher multiplier creates uneven session results. A player may string together several modest cash-outs and then lose one or two rounds by staying too long. The game’s swings are often driven as much by player timing as by the underlying result generation.

The tempo is another defining factor. Chicken Road usually runs quickly. There is little downtime, which many users enjoy on mobile or during short sessions. But speed has a cost: it can reduce the time available to think. One memorable truth about games like this is that they rarely feel expensive one round at a time; they feel expensive after ten fast decisions in a row.

Gameplay element What it means in practice
Rising multiplier The longer you stay in, the larger the potential return, but the greater the risk
Cash-out decision Your timing determines whether you secure a result or lose the round
Fast round cycle Good for quick sessions, but easy to overplay without noticing
Simple interface Easy to learn, especially for players who dislike complex slot layouts
High tension per round Creates excitement, but can encourage chasing behaviour

Strengths, grey areas, and limits that should not be ignored

The strongest side of Chicken Road is clarity. The objective is obvious, the action is fast, and the game can be engaging from the first round. If Paddy power casino provides a clean launch and stable mobile play, that simplicity becomes a real advantage rather than just a marketing point.

Another strength is session flexibility. You do not need a long commitment to understand whether the title suits you. A short demo or a few carefully controlled rounds can tell you a lot. This is useful for players who want to test a format without spending time learning a complex paytable.

The main grey area is that the game can create a misleading sense of control. Because you choose when to cash out, it may feel more skill-based than it really is. That can push some users into chasing a “better exit” on the next round. In reality, the title remains a gambling product driven by chance, not a strategy game that can be solved through timing alone.

There are also practical limitations to watch. Demo mode may not always be available. Some users may find the pace too fast for comfortable real money play. Others may discover that the mobile interface is acceptable but not ideal on smaller screens. These are not deal-breakers, but they matter enough to check before committing funds.
